Man gets prison time for DUIs, running over wife with truck

ALLENTOWN (AP) — An eastern Pennsylvania man is heading to prison after admitting he mixed alcohol and prescription medications when he drove drunk and ran over his wife.

The Morning Call of Allentown reports Edward Clark Jr. was sentenced Tuesday to one to seven years in prison.

The 68-year-old Allentown resident pleaded guilty in December to drunken driving and aggravated assault stemming from several incidents.

Police say Clark and his wife were arguing in their driveway last January when he ran her over, throwing her to the pavement. She suffered several broken bones.

He was arrested again in June after hitting five mailboxes with his 10-year-old son in the pickup.

Clark told a Lehigh County judge he hopes his wife forgives him.
